9:20 I'm literally coming back to MtG after playing Battle Spirits Saga since that game launched because Bandai did this to their first 3 sets, killed the market, burned stores that stopped supporting the game, killing local scenes causing players to sell out further plummeting card prices. Several stores I know lost $1000's, and one over $10,000. Seriously, 6 months into launch of the game and set 1 and 2 boxes were $20 and $25, when distributor costs were +/-$75. The game went into absolute freefall, and the only thing stabilizing the prices of the latest set is that there are no players left and sets are now printed to pre-order demand.
Apples to oranges. BSS was a trash game that had already failed once, no one asked for again, and had an audience that was entirely limited to cannibalizing Bandai’s other games. Bandai literally started the launch by trying to pay people to play the game, hoping that would draw in enough players to get the game off the ground. It was dead on arrival.
@@sergioperez2771 I'm torn on the game, though did win a few thousand $ the first year of their attempt at a competitive circuit, which honestly might be the only reason why I've stuck out so long lol.
The game engine / mechanics are quite good. They paid a former MtG lead dev to design the game, and that part is great. However, their card and set design itself is complete dog water. Since set one, there have been maybe two dozen cards in sets 2-4 combined that really "exist" in a game, especially with a single format/meta. No joke, 90% of the cards printed might as well go straight into the recycling bin.
The idea of draft and sealed formats were a completely foreign concept to the developers (no joke, like we literally talked to their representatives at events). I swear, you'd think they never heard of a card game before with some of the preconceptions they had.
Bandai is a company so completely out of touch with the TCG market, I swear it is a miracle their other games even survive. The only thing they have going for them is their IP recognition.
